Visual description

Extremely long perspective corridor rendered in warm monochromatic tones: dusty pink walls, beige-tan flooring, and brown-toned columns and arches. A single white modernist chair sits centered in the middle distance, small and isolated. Repeated geometric arches recede into the background, creating strong linear perspective and rhythm. Strong directional lighting casts sharp geometric shadows across the floor and walls, entering through tall openings on the left. The entire composition has a serene, contemplative quality with perfectly smooth surfaces and clean geometry. Professional 3D rendering with sophisticated lighting and material properties.

Key takeaway

Monochromatic rendering focuses attention on form, space, light, and proportion without color distraction. A single contrasting element (the white chair) becomes a focal point and establishes scale in vast space.
